Crestmont is a residential neighbourhood in the southwest quadrant of Calgary, Alberta. It is located at the western edge of the city, south of the Trans-Canada Highway.

It is represented in the Calgary City Council by the Ward 1 councillor.

Demographics[]

In the City of Calgary's 2012 municipal census, Crestmont had a population of 1,454 living in 462 dwellings, a 1.7% increase from its 2011 population of 1,430.[3] With a land area of 0.6 km2 (0.23 sq mi), it had a population density of 2,420/km2 (6,300/sq mi) in 2012.[4][3]
